Originally Posted by Iride01
How many trees will be needed to match the current production of steel, carbon and aluminum bikes?

Will the consumers desire for unique species cause issues with the rain forests and such?
A lot of energy/carbon is required to make carbon steel, as well as energy for aluminum, and I presume also various carbon/graphite technologies.

Renovo does use unique woods, I think. However, one of the big businesses is recycling urban trees/lumber, where one often finds quite unique trees that people have planted, but for one reason or another eventually require pruning or removal.
